Output e6269f9f31e4f156bb330e3ddf57e4be61a88511608b574bd4c685cef8caae04:141

value
1153084
script pubkey
OP_0 OP_PUSHBYTES_20 c596b5d80b90703b5a0c0ffb0403fb11fa566ec3
address
bc1qcktttkqtjpcrkksvplasgqlmz8a9vmkrw2klx8
transaction
e6269f9f31e4f156bb330e3ddf57e4be61a88511608b574bd4c685cef8caae04
confirmations
116576
spent
true